Proposed Collection; Comment Request for Notice 2012-48

AGENCY: Internal Revenue Service (IRS), Treasury.

ACTION: Notice and request for comments.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: The Department of the Treasury, as part of its continuing 
effort to reduce paperwork and respondent burden, invites the general 
public and other Federal agencies to take this opportunity to comment 
on proposed and/or continuing information collections, as required by 
the Paperwork Reduction Act of 1995, Public Law 104-13 (44 U.S.C. 
3506(c)(2)(A)). The IRS is soliciting comments concerning information 
collection requirements related to Notice 2012-48, Tribal Economic 
Development Bonds.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:
    Title: Tribal Economic Development Bonds.
    OMB Number: 1545-2233.
    Notice Number: Notice 2012-48.
    Abstract: This Notice solicits applications for the reallocation of 
available amounts of national bond issuance authority limitation for 
tribal economic development bonds (``Tribal Economic Development 
Bonds'') that were previously allocated to eligible issuers by the 
Internal Revenue Service (``IRS'') and that have not been used. This 
Notice also provides related guidance on: (1) The application 
requirements and forms for requests for volume cap allocations, and (2) 
the method that the IRS and the Department of the Treasury will use to 
allocate the volume cap.
    Current Actions: There are no changes being made to the burden 
previously requested at this time.
    Type of Review: Extension of a currently approved collection.
    Affected Public: Tribal governments.
    Estimated Number of Respondents: 143.
    Estimated Average Time per Respondent: 7 hours.
    Estimated Total Annual Burden Hours: 1,000.
